Description
Nos. 35 and 36 High Street is a house and shop that consists of one building. It is believed to have been constructed before 1600 and was refronted in the late 18th century. The building has a four-storey stuccoed modern front that is supported by timber framing, featuring a moulded eaves cornice and a deep moulded parapet. There are two splayed bay windows that extend up to the four storeys, along with 18th-century style sash windows and a double shop front in the same style. The interior has been extensively modernised. Historical records of leases and tenants from 1552 to 1863 can be found in the Oxford Historic Society publication. All the listed buildings on the north side of the street form a group.
